V$sqlarea.buffer_gets and v$sqlarea.sorts

What exactly the meaning of the fields ?
What conclusion I can get from higher result ?
v$sqlarea.buffer_gets
v$sqlarea.sorts
I seek for more knowledge and deep understanding then the table description
BUFFER_GETS     NUMBER     Sum of buffer gets over all child cursors
SORTS     NUMBER     Sum of the number of sorts that were done for all the child cursors
Thanks

No, the count is a total count that has happened. See below, I have an 11g (11106) db started and I fired up the query from scott for some data. You can see the counts are increasing all the time.

  • Buffer_gets and 'session logical reads'

    When I compare the following values:
    select sum(buffer_gets) from v$sqlarea
    and
    select value from v$sysstat where name='session logical reads'
    it usually happens that sum(buffer_gets) > 'session logical reads'.
    Does buffer_gets include logical and physical reads? As long as the SGA keeps all the SQL statments, I guess sum(buffer_gets) will be bigger than 'session logical reads'. Is this correct?
    Thxs

    Hi,
    buffer gets = number of times a block was requested from buffer cache. A buffer get always request in a logical read. Depending on whether or not a copy of the block is available in the buffer cache, a logical read may or may not involve a physical read. So "buffer gets" and "logical reads" are basically synonyms and are often used interchangeably.
    Oracle doesn't have a special "undo buffer". Undo blocks are stored in rollback segments in UNDO tablespace, and are managed in the same way data blocks are (they're even protected by redo). If a consistent get requires reading from UNDO tablespace, then statistics counters will show that, i.e. there will be one more consistent get in your autotrace.

  • Report: sorting of data and temporary table sorting

    We have a report that runs a procedure, which inserts data into a temporary table using the supplied parameters. The report then selects data from this table.
    Previously the report has always displayed data in the same order in which it was inserted into the table, even though no sorting is specified by the report itself. I realize that the report itself ought to specify the sorting in order to guarantee it, but this has worked in the past.
    As part of an application/Oracle upgrade the report has been recompiled. Data is now displayed in a different order as before. However, each time we run it now, it IS the same (new) sorting. So it's still consistent, but consistent in a different way than before.
    Is there some way to go back to the old sorting (display in same order as inserted into table) - without having to re-code this (and all the other) reports in order to specify the sorting? We think that data is still inserted into the temporary table in the same order as before. We are using the same version of Crystal Reports.
    Edited by: user489847 on May 31, 2010 4:01 AM

    Crystal Reports.This is the Oracle Reports forum.
    Anyway, I have seen this in one of our applications too. Suddenly the ordering was different, because there was no explicit order by. There is never a guarantee of the ordering if you do not specify it.
    You should ask this in the database forum too, since this is not really Reports related.
